windows下qt开发环境搭建

windows下qt的开发环境搭建

1.qt官网上下载最新的qt library,Qt libraries 4.6.4 for Windows (VS 2008),安装,安装路径不能有空格

http://get.qt.nokia.com/qt/source/qt-win-opensource-4.7.4-vs2008.exe

2.下载Qt Visual Studio Add-in ,安装

安装完成后,在vs2008中会发现多了Qt的菜单

3.设置visual assist的自动提示,custom include files添加qt的include路径,src files添加qt的src路径


这样便安装完成qt库及一些bin文件,便可以debug和release程序,可以进行qt开发了,写一个“hello, qt”试验一下


hello,qt

新建vs2008工程,选择Qt Console Application,记得选上Gui Library,在Console Application中默认是没有选上的,工程如下

#include 
#include 

int main(int argc, char *argv[])
{
    QApplication a(argc, argv);

    QLabel *lab = new QLabel("hello, qt");

    lab->setAttribute(Qt::WA_DeleteOnClose);

    lab->show();

    return a.exec();
}

 lab->setAttribute(Qt::WA_DeleteOnClose)是为了关闭窗口,释放内存


编译运行


至此就完成了一个简单的hello,qt的程序,没有设置PATH, QTDIR等环境变量,没有编译QT for Windows开发的库这样很方便的对qt进行学习。当然了也可以自己nmake出qt库,然后使用。


你可能感兴趣的:(Qt)